Single pulse dust collector

Brief introduction
Single pulse dust collector is a kind of highly efficient collector which is designed on the base of overseas advanced technology. It combines advantage of locellus blowback dust collector and jetting pulse cleaning dust collector, avoids less strength of locellus blowback and simultaneous re-absorbing of jetting pulse cleaning dust and filter. It adopts highly efficient off-line method, so it can clean dust with larger capacity, higher efficiency, lower system resistance, longer life of filter-bag, etc. It is widely used to collect dust in grinder, crusher, packing machine, silo top, matching materials of cement industry. It can clean not only air with common dust, but air with high density (even 1300g/Nm³), so it can collect final product of vertical mill and 0-sepa separator. It can be also widely used in grain, light industry, electric power, chemical industry, metallurgy, etc.
Features
1. Off-line method cleans dust and dust collecting efficiency can reach 99.99%, there is no second dust absorbing, so it is suitable to deal with smoke with high density, and can directly collect product with high density.
2. Filter material with high quality can meet any working condition.
3. PLC intelligent controlling system can be operated easily, precisely and reliably.
4. Gas tank structure and module manufacturing make installation much easier.
5. Advanced balancing wind design reduces operating resistance of dust collector.
